What Are Lipids?
Lipids are a broad family of molecules that share one key trait: they’re largely non‑polar, meaning they don’t mix well with water. This group includes fats, oils, waxes, phospholipids, and even some steroid hormones. When most people hear “lipids,” they picture the butter on their toast or the oil you drizzle over a salad, but the category is much wider. Which means in the kitchen, you’ll find triglycerides (the main storage form of fat in animals), while in cell membranes phospholipids do the heavy lifting, forming bilayers that keep cells intact. Cholesterol, another lipid, helps maintain membrane fluidity and serves as a building block for hormones. Types of Lipids
- Triglycerides – the most common form, made of glycerol and three fatty acids. They’re the primary energy reservoir in adipose tissue.
- Phospholipids – two fatty acids, a phosphate group, and a glycerol backbone. They’re the structural heroes of cell membranes.
- Steroids – four fused carbon rings, including cholesterol and sex hormones.
- Waxes – esters of long‑chain fatty acids and long‑chain alcohols, found in cuticles of plants and animals.
Each type plays a distinct role, but they all deliver energy in roughly the same amount per gram.

Energy Density and Body Function
When you eat, your body breaks down lipids into fatty acids and glycerol, which then enter the bloodstream. Also, because the chemical bonds in fat are more reduced than those in carbs, the oxidation process yields more energy per gram. Those fatty acids are either used immediately for fuel, stored in adipose tissue, or oxidized in the mitochondria to produce ATP. How Lipids Work in the Body
Digestion and Absorption
When you eat a fatty meal, the process starts in the mouth with lingual lipase, continues in the stomach with gastric lipase, and really takes off in the small intestine thanks to pancreatic lipase. Bile salts emulsify the fat, breaking large droplets into smaller ones that enzymes can attack. In real terms, the resulting monoglycerides and free fatty acids are then packaged into chylomicrons, which travel through the lymphatic system and eventually into the bloodstream. Once in circulation, these lipids are taken up by muscle, adipose tissue, or the liver, depending on the body’s needs And that's really what it comes down to. Surprisingly effective..
Because lipids are hydrophobic, they rely on carrier proteins and transport complexes to move through the aqueous environment of the blood. Common Misconceptions
Fat Is Bad
One of the most persistent myths is that all fat is unhealthy. Unsaturated fats — monounsaturated and polyunsaturated — are generally considered heart‑healthy, and omega‑3 fatty acids, a type of polyunsaturated fat, have anti‑inflammatory properties. Still, saturated fats, found in butter and red meat, have been linked to increased LDL cholesterol in some studies, but they also provide satiety and can be part of a balanced diet when consumed in moderation. So naturally, in reality, the type of fat matters far more than the mere presence of fat. So labeling all lipids as “bad” oversimplifies a nuanced picture Worth knowing..
All Lipids Are the Same
Another misconception is that a gram of butter is identical to a gram of olive oil in terms of health impact. While the caloric density is the same, the fatty acid composition differs dramatically. Butter is high in saturated fatty acids, whereas olive oil is rich in monounsaturated oleic acid. Those differences affect cholesterol levels, inflammation, and even flavor. Recognizing that the source of the lipid changes its nutritional profile helps you make smarter choices rather than just counting grams.

Practical Tips for Using This Info
Reading Nutrition Labels
When you look at a nutrition facts panel, the calorie count per serving is usually derived from the total grams of fat, protein, and carbs. Because of that, for example, if a label shows 10 g of fat, that’s roughly 90 calories from fat alone. Because fat contributes 9 calories per gram, you can quickly estimate the fat‑derived calories by multiplying the fat grams by 9.
